Transaction 63e8b7c5de55ad993a0d886a8483fa0c904e4d563dab10bae6474faca8551468
1 Input
1 Output
-
63e8b7c5de55ad993a0d886a8483fa0c904e4d563dab10bae6474faca8551468:0
- value
- 44105
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0f42a0ef7cd29b94ea52b6d9da6af828c1b2a63 OP_EQUAL
- address
- 3GN4Y4xFh8fv7LtaS3ffea65qvojhK59pg